About this listen

A finalist in the Action/Adenture Fiction category of the 2011 Next Generation Indie Book Awards.

Above All, the third of the John Jospeh Sharpe trilogy series following America's Diplomats and Eyes of the Blind, is a lighthearted action-adventure historical fiction set in the waning stages of the Vietnam War. The story which pits a consummate warrior against the political strangulation that rendered our armed forces virtually incompetent. It is a comical but sordid tale of a roguish gunship pilot and his nemesis, a petty commanding officer, who loathe each other at first sight. As fierce adversaries, they encompass the chaos of that era. They're accompanied by a coven of nurses and a clandestine army of misfits who portray the best and worst of our country during that painful event. Their saga is one of love and lust, hope and despair, valor and cowardice, awash in a deluge of demoralizing apathy as they face the bitter ending of the conflict.
